Understanding Facebook and Instagram Marketing
Facebook and Instagram marketing involve utilizing these popular social media platforms to promote products, services, and brands. With billions of active users, both platforms provide businesses with extensive reach and engagement opportunities. Facebook focuses on connecting people through a variety of content types, while Instagram emphasizes visual storytelling through images and videos. Leveraging these platforms effectively can lead to increased brand awareness, customer engagement, and ultimately, sales.
Creating Engaging Content
The foundation of successful marketing on Facebook and Instagram lies in creating engaging content that resonates with the target audience. This includes high-quality images, videos, stories, and interactive posts that encourage likes, comments, and shares. For Facebook, a mix of content types, such as articles, polls, and live videos, can help capture attention and foster community interaction. On Instagram, visually appealing posts and stories are key; brands often utilize aesthetic themes and user-generated content to enhance their presence.
Utilizing Advertising Options
Both platforms offer robust advertising options to reach specific demographics and drive targeted traffic. Facebook Ads allow businesses to create highly customizable campaigns based on user interests, behaviors, and demographics. Instagram Ads, integrated seamlessly into the platform, leverage eye-catching visuals and can appear as posts, stories, or shopping ads. Utilizing these advertising tools effectively enables businesses to maximize their visibility and reach potential customers where they spend their time.
Building a Community
Engagement is crucial for building a loyal community on social media. Responding to comments, messages, and mentions fosters a sense of connection and trust between the brand and its audience. Regularly interacting with followers through polls, Q&A sessions, and contests can further enhance engagement. Additionally, collaborating with influencers or industry leaders can help brands tap into new audiences and build credibility within their niche.
Analyzing Performance
To measure the effectiveness of marketing efforts on Facebook and Instagram, businesses must regularly analyze performance metrics. Key performance indicators (KPIs) include engagement rates, reach, impressions, and conversion rates. Tools like Facebook Insights and Instagram Analytics provide valuable data to track the success of posts and campaigns. By understanding what works and what doesn’t, brands can refine their strategies to improve overall performance and ROI.
The Future of Social Media Marketing
As social media continues to evolve, so do the strategies for effective marketing on platforms like Facebook and Instagram. Trends such as shoppable posts, augmented reality experiences, and short-form video content are gaining popularity and shaping user expectations. Businesses will need to adapt to these changes by embracing new technologies and staying attuned to audience preferences. By remaining flexible and innovative, brands can effectively navigate the dynamic landscape of social media marketing, ensuring sustained growth and engagement.
